Summary

CVE-2025-4302 is a medium-severity an unspecified weakness vulnerability in Fullworksplugins Stop User Enumeration. Its CVSS base score is 5.3 (Medium).

Operationally, ranked in the top 18.6% of CVEs by exploit likelihood; it is not currently listed in the CISA KEV catalog; a public proof-of-concept is referenced.

Vulnerability details

The Stop User Enumeration WordPress plugin before version 1.7.3 blocks REST API /wp-json/wp/v2/users/ requests for non-authorized users. However, this can be bypassed by URL-encoding the API path.
